Welcome to Canary District Condos, Suite S221! This suite combines thoughtful design, modern finishes, and community-centric conveniences for an elevated urban experience. With over 600 square feet of sun-soaked living space, every room is brightened by floor-to-ceiling windows, while hardwood floors trace a well-appointed layout framed by soaring 10-foot ceilings. Added bonus of having Beanfield high-speed internet included! Step outside and discover an incredible array of neighbourhood hotspots: dine at local favourites like Souk Tabule and White Lily Diner, sip craft coffee at Dark Horse Espresso, or unwind along the lush trails of Corktown Common and the Don River Valley Park. Just minutes away, the Distillery District and Riverside offer even more vibrant culture, boutique shopping, and galleries. Residents enjoy effortless connectivity with Beanfield Internet included, easy TTC access via the 504 King and 514 Cherry streetcars, and quick links to the DVP and Gardiner Expressway. Cyclists will appreciate nearby trails such as the Martin Goodman Trail and Richmond-Adelaide bike lanes. Inside, the suite features wall-to-wall hardwood, quartz countertops, and contemporary finishes, accompanied by a private balcony overlooking the community's inviting atmosphere. Things to Confirm Before Signing
· Are utilities included, or separate?
· How many parking spots are included?
· Is the landlord open to a 1-year or 2-year lease?
· Are pets and small renovations (paint, hooks) allowed?
· When was the last rent increase, if there is a prior tenant?
Utility estimates are approximate and vary by season, habits, and what the landlord includes. Always confirm inclusions with the listing agent.

Lease Terms to Negotiate
Don't just focus on the monthly rent — the lease terms matter just as much. I always advise my rental clients to clarify: what's included (parking, storage, utilities), the lease length options, the landlord's policy on renewals, and whether small personalizations like painting are permitted. These details can make or break your experience over 12–24 months.
